P2153 Fault Code
P2153 OBD-II Trouble Code Short Description
Fuel Injector Group C Supply Voltage Circuit Low
What does trouble code P2153 mean?
The P2153 fault code indicates that there is a low supply voltage in the fuel injector group C circuit. This can affect the performance of the engine's fuel injection system, leading to inadequate fuel delivery and potential engine misfires.
Symptoms
What are the symptoms of the P2153 code?
- Engine may exhibit a rough idle or misfire.
- Reduced engine performance, especially during acceleration.
- Possible stalling or difficulty starting the vehicle.
- Check Engine Light (CEL) illuminated on the dashboard.
Causes
What causes the P2153 code?
- Damaged wiring or connectors in the fuel injector circuit.
- Blown fuse related to the fuel injector circuit.
- Faulty fuel injector causing increased resistance or malfunction.
- Issues with the engine control module (ECM) that may lead to incorrect voltage readings.
Possible Solutions
How to fix P2153?
- Inspect and repair any damaged wiring or connectors in the fuel injector circuit.
- Replace any blown fuses that affect the fuel injection system.
- Test and, if necessary, replace faulty fuel injectors.
- Use a diagnostic tool to check for further ECM issues and reprogram or replace the ECM if needed.
